PowerShell

Rozwiązywanie problemów z siecią za pomocą wiersza poleceń programu PowerShell: rozwiązywanie problemów z połączeniem

W dzisiejszym cyfrowym świecie łączność sieciowa jest niezbędna zarówno dla firm, jak i osób prywatnych. Jednak problemy z siecią mogą pojawiać się z różnych powodów, prowadząc do zakłóceń w komunikacji, przesyłaniu danych i ogólnej produktywności. PowerShell, potężne narzędzie wiersza poleceń w systemie Windows, oferuje kompleksowy zestaw poleceń i narzędzi do rozwiązywania problemów sieciowych i rozwiązywania problemów z łącznością.

Rozwiązywanie problemów z siecią za pomocą wiersza poleceń programu PowerShell: rozwiązywanie problemów z łącznością

Podstawowa Wiedza Na Temat Połączeń Sieciowych

Przed zagłębieniem się w polecenia programu PowerShell ważne jest zrozumienie podstawowych pojęć związanych z łącznością sieciową. Adresy IP, podsieci i bramy odgrywają kluczową rolę w nawiązywaniu i utrzymywaniu połączeń sieciowych. Typowe topologie sieciowe, takie jak gwiazda, magistrala i pierścień, mają różne cechy i konsekwencje dla łączności. Zrozumienie tych pojęć pomaga skutecznie identyfikować i rozwiązywać problemy sieciowe.

Polecenia Programu PowerShell Do Rozwiązywania Problemów Z Siecią

Program PowerShell oferuje szeroki zakres poleceń specjalnie zaprojektowanych do rozwiązywania problemów z siecią. Te polecenia pozwalają specjalistom IT i administratorom sieci zbierać informacje o konfiguracji sieci, diagnozować problemy z łącznością i skutecznie rozwiązywać problemy.

Polecenie Opis
Get-NetAdapter Wyświetla informacje o kartach sieciowych i ich konfiguracjach.
Get-NetIPConfiguration Pobiera szczegóły konfiguracji IP dla określonej karty sieciowej.
Test-Connection Testuje połączenie sieciowe z określonym hostem lub adresem IP.
Resolve-DnsName Rozwiązuje nazwę DNS na adres IP.
Ping Wysyła żądania echa ICMP do określonego hosta w celu sprawdzenia połączenia sieciowego.

Rozwiązywanie Typowych Problemów Sieciowych

Poleceń programu PowerShell można używać do rozwiązywania różnych typowych problemów sieciowych, w tym:

  • Konflikty adresów IP: Polecenia programu PowerShell mogą pomóc w identyfikowaniu i rozwiązywaniu konfliktów adresów IP, które występują, gdy wielu urządzeniom w sieci przypisywany jest ten sam adres IP.
  • Problemy z łącznością z bramą: Poleceń programu PowerShell można użyć do przetestowania połączenia z domyślną bramą i zdiagnozowania problemów związanych z konfiguracją bramy.
  • Problemy z rozwiązywaniem nazw DNS: Polecenia programu PowerShell mogą pomóc w rozwiązywaniu problemów z rozwiązywaniem nazw DNS, które mogą uniemożliwić urządzeniom łączenie się ze stronami internetowymi lub innymi zasobami sieciowymi.
  • Problemy z trasowaniem: Poleceń programu PowerShell można użyć do analizy tabel trasowania i identyfikowania problemów, które mogą powodować, że ruch sieciowy przejmuje nieefektywne lub nieprawidłowe ścieżki.
  • Problemy z zaporą i bezpieczeństwem: Poleceń programu PowerShell można użyć do konfigurowania i rozwiązywania problemów z ustawieniami zapory, a także do badania problemów związanych z bezpieczeństwem, które mogą mieć wpływ na łączność sieciową.

Zaawansowane Techniki Rozwiązywania Problemów

W przypadku bardziej złożonych problemów sieciowych program PowerShell oferuje zaawansowane techniki rozwiązywania problemów, takie jak:

  • Analiza ruchu sieciowego: Poleceń programu PowerShell można użyć do przechwytywania i analizowania ruchu sieciowego, co pomaga w identyfikowaniu wąskich gardeł wydajności i potencjalnych zagrożeń bezpieczeństwa.
  • Identyfikacja wąskich gardeł wydajności: Poleceń programu PowerShell można użyć do monitorowania wydajności sieci i identyfikowania obszarów, w których można wprowadzić ulepszenia w celu optymalizacji prędkości i wydajności sieci.
  • Rozwiązywanie problemów z bezpieczeństwem sieci: Poleceń programu PowerShell można użyć do badania incydentów bezpieczeństwa, analizowania dzienników bezpieczeństwa i wdrażania środków bezpieczeństwa w celu ochrony sieci przed nieautoryzowanym dostępem i atakami.

Najlepsze Praktyki Rozwiązywania Problemów Z Siecią

Skuteczne rozwiązywanie problemów z siecią za pomocą programu PowerShell wymaga przestrzegania najlepszych praktyk, takich jak:

  • Zebranie odpowiednich informacji: Przed rozwiązaniem problemu zbierz odpowiednie informacje o konfiguracji sieci, w tym adresy IP, maski podsieci, adresy bram i adresy serwerów DNS.
  • Dokumentowanie kroków rozwiązywania problemów: Prowadź szczegółowy rejestr podjętych kroków rozwiązywania problemów, wraz z wynikami i wszelkimi zmianami wprowadzonymi w konfiguracji sieci.
  • Eskalacja problemów w razie potrzeby: Jeśli problemu nie można rozwiązać za pomocą poleceń programu PowerShell, przekaż problem do wyższego poziomu wsparcia lub zaangażuj specjalistę ds. sieci.

Program PowerShell jest potężnym narzędziem do rozwiązywania problemów z siecią i rozwiązywania problemów z łącznością. Dzięki zrozumieniu pojęć związanych z łącznością sieciową, skutecznemu wykorzystaniu poleceń programu PowerShell i przestrzeganiu najlepszych praktyk specjaliści IT i administratorzy sieci mogą skutecznie diagnozować i rozwiązywać problemy sieciowe, zapewniając optymalną wydajność i produktywność sieci.

Thank you for the feedback

Zostaw odpowiedź